DIY Kid-made Father’s Day Art
DIY Kid-made Father’s Day Art

It became such a special book for Cam and her dad that it inspired a Father’s Day gift the following year.

It is such a simple but effective piece of art that my husband proudly displays.  I thought I’d share the art with you in the lead up to Father’s Day 2013.

It’s super easy and if your kids are anything like my Cam, they will have lots of fun creating it.

WHAT YOU NEED:

  • Our ‘Kisses for Daddy’ template.
  • Lipstick
  • A clipboard
  • A frame (6”x 8”)

HOW TO CREATE THIS KID-MADE ART FOR FATHER’S DAY:

  1. Print the‘Kisses for Daddy’template
  2. Apply loads of lipstick
  3. Kiss, kiss and kiss the template some more. The more kisses the better.  (We reapply the lipstick in different shades for a colourful effect)
  4. Trim the page to fit the frame and add a special message for your dad.
  5. Frame
  6.  Make your dad happy this Father’s Day. It will look great displayed on his desk.

About Kisses for Daddy:

Author: Frances Watts

Illustrator: David Legge

ISBN:978-1877003783

Format: Hardcover

Publisher: Little Hare (Hardie Grant Egmont), January 2006

Suitable for children aged 3+ (★★★★★)

Daddy’s Kisses an utterly adorable and warm story about a grumbly little bear, who plays a fun game with his dad before bedtime. Dad is trying incredibly hard to get a kiss out of his son but without any luck. The illustrations are so detailed and life-like, with lots of hidden animals to search for in each illustration.
